Heads up: the Brindlemoor intern cohort arrives Monday morning, about fifteen of them. Please wave them through to the Fernhollow breakout area and tick names off the list we'll send over. They won't have passes until Wednesday, so escort any stragglers yourself. For the side entrance, use the code below.

staff pass of kawip-hawef = bdg-QLP-2

Managers-Only Wiki — Support Outsourcing Plan, Quillharbor Software. Proposal: move tier-1 support to Averlane Partners by Q2. Scope: chat and email only; phone stays in-house. Projected savings 18% annually; transition risk rated moderate. Staffing impacts under separate review. For the incoming director, the key strategic background is captured in the note below.

management briefing: Project Ulavan slips by two quarters because of the staffing delay.

**Mgmt Meeting Minutes — Retiring the Brightline Range**

Quick recap for sales leads at Fenholt Supplies: we agreed to retire the Brightline fixture range by year-end. Remaining stock moves to clearance pricing next month, and accounts on standing orders get migrated to the Lumetta range. Trade-in incentives were approved in principle. The confidential note on next steps sits just below.

board note of bajof-bajeg: The pricing group signed off on a budget of $13.4 million for Project Sildor. The renewal with Lamixek Holdings closes at $48.9 million a year, 49 percent above the last contract.

## Deployment

Gridmere partitions the `events` table by calendar month, and new partitions must exist before the first write of each month arrives. The deploy pipeline runs the partition-provisioning job automatically, but verify it completed before routing traffic, as missing partitions cause hard insert failures. The job reads its settings from the values shown directly below this section.

service settings:
druael:
  pin: 7528
  metrics_host: metrics.druael.lumiclabs.internal
  tenant: wendor
  seal: seal_c765840a

### v3.8.2 — Changelog

- Fixed websocket reconnect loop in the Quillgate relay: stale session tokens were reused after a dropped connection, causing infinite 401 retries. Reconnect now re-handshakes with fresh credentials and backs off exponentially, capped at 60s.
- No schema changes. No client update required.

Regression test added to the relay suite. Sign-off and follow-up questions go to the engineer below.

named custodian: Brivan Eliath Quenox Frador